What moves the price on a 2011 Ford F-350

The $17,500–$27,748 typical range isn't randomness — three factors explain most of it:

Location
Biggest factor
up to $16,992

The same car typically asks $12,995 in North Dakota but $29,987 in Wyoming.

Mileage
up to $9,548

Asking prices run about $29,900 at 15K–30K miles and fall to $20,352 over 105K miles — roughly $1,100 for every 10,000 miles.

Trim
up to $5,148

The XL typically asks $19,181, while the Lariat asks $24,329 — same year, same market.

Frequently asked questions

Why do 2011 Ford F-350 prices range from $8,380 to $39,559?

The spread comes down to configuration and mileage: higher-mileage, base-configuration examples sit near the low end, while low-mileage and premium configurations reach the top. Half of all listings fall between $17,500 and $27,748 — see the mileage and trim breakdowns above for where a specific vehicle lands.

How much should mileage change the price of a 2011 Ford F-350?

Expect roughly $1,100 less for every 10,000 miles on the odometer. A 60K-mile example should cost about $3,300 less than a 30K-mile one of the same trim — check the fair-price-by-mileage table above for your band.

How we calculate these prices

We track 223 active listings for this vehicle across dealer sites nationwide, updated every day. Average and median are computed from real asking prices on live listings. We exclude the top and bottom 2% of prices to reduce the influence of extreme values. This does not verify title status or guarantee that every erroneous listing is excluded. Prices reflect dealer asking prices — not final sale prices — and exclude taxes, fees, and incentives. Trim and mileage move the price more than any other factor; see the breakdowns above.
